Boralex has been providing renewable and affordable energy for over 30 years. The Group, composed of more than 800 employees, operatesrenewable assets with an installed capacity of over 3 GW and is developing a project portfolio of 6.8 GW in wind, solar, and energy storage.

⚡ You will play an important role in:Under the supervision of the Manager – Operational Accounting US, the holder of this position will perform the complete accounting cycle tasks for various companies.

  • Prepare month-end, quarter-end, and year-end files according to the group’s procedures, standards, and internal control rules;
  • Provide support to the Manager in preparing monthly and quarterly financial statements;
  • Participate in the production of the budget for the entities under their charge;
  • Ensure the reliability of data by meeting the deadlines set by the group and highlighting discrepancies;
  • Collaborate in optimizing methods, tools, and processes;
  • Work closely with the team to ensure interventions align with business objectives;
  • Collaborate closely with all departments;
  • Perform all related accounting tasks.

💡 To succeed in this position, you need:

  • Hold active CPA license (asset);
  • 5 to 7 years of relevant experience (public accounting experience is an asset);
  • Experience in financial statement preparation and analytical review of reporting produced (essential)
  • Ability to translate financial results to digestible summaries for stakeholders (essential)
  • Knowledge of IFRS and US GAAP standards (complex topics);
  • Experience in business acquisitions (an asset);
  • Knowledge of the Office suite (essential);
  • Knowledge of SAP and Longview (an asset);
  • Demonstrate autonomy, initiative, and the ability to advance complex files;
  • A good team spirit with strong analytical skills;
  • Rigor, organizational skills, and the ability to manage multiple files simultaneously;
  • Respect for objectives and deadlines.
